So, Painkiller Jane is this intriguing blend of action and science fiction, right? It dives into the world of a soldier, Jane, who gets hit by a biochemical weapon that gives her these wild self-healing powers. It's got this gritty, almost underground feel, and the pacing is pretty steady, keeping you engaged without too many lulls. The practical effects they used for her transformations and injuries lend an interesting texture to the story. It's not just about the action; there's this underlying theme of her struggle against the military and what it means to have such power. The performances, while not always stellar, bring a certain earnestness that you don't find in every TV movie. Overall, it’s distinctive for its take on the hero's journey in a less conventional way.
